# Razing Snidd Razing Snidd represents a curious footnote in Magic's design history as an uncommon creature from Planeshift with an unusual mechanical identity. The card appeals primarily to collectors interested in niche strategies rather than competitive play. Its modest power level means it rarely commands attention in the secondary market, making it an affordable pickup for set completionists. The foil variant exists but carries minimal premium value given the card's overall obscurity. Collectors pursuing Planeshift sets or those documenting Magic's experimental creature designs from the late 1990s may seek it out, though it remains overshadowed by more impactful cards from the same era. It's the type of card that matters more for collection completion than individual desirability.
